Open Commission Meeting Wednesday, January 15, 2025

January 8, 2025.

The Federal Communications Commission will hold an Open Meeting on the subjects listed below on Wednesday, January 15, 2025, which is scheduled to commence at 10:30 a.m. in the Commission Meeting Room of the Federal Communications Commission, 45 L Street NE, Washington, DC.


[top] While attendance at the Open Meeting is available to the public, the FCC page 10926 headquarters building is not open access and all guests must check in with and be screened by FCC security at the main entrance on L Street. Attendees at the Open Meeting will not be required to have an appointment but must otherwise comply with protocols outlined at: www.fcc.gov/visit. Open Meetings are streamed live at: www.fcc.gov/live and on the FCC's YouTube channel.

Panel No. Bureau Subject
ONE Consumer & Governmental Affairs, Office of Economics and Analytics, Office of International Affairs and Broadband Data Task Force The Commission will hear presentations from the Consumer & Governmental Affairs Bureau, the Office of International Affairs, the Broadband Data Task Force and the Office of Economics and Analytics on the agency's work on expanding connectivity and access to modern communications.
TWO Wireline Competition, Office of Workplace Diversity, Office of Communications Business Opportunities and Connect2Health/Office of General Counsel The Commission will hear presentations from the Wireline Competition Bureau, the Office of Workplace Diversity, the Office of Communications Business Opportunities and the Connect2Health Chair/Office of General Counsel on the agency's work on making communications more just for more people in more places.
THREE Public Safety and Homeland Security, Enforcement, Media, Wireline Competition, Consumer & Governmental Affairs, Office of Engineering and Technology and Office of International Affairs The Commission will hear presentations from the Public Safety and Homeland Security Bureau, the Enforcement Bureau, the Media Bureau, the Wireline Competition Bureau, the Consumer & Governmental Affairs Bureau, the Office of Engineering and Technology and the Office of International Affairs on the agency's work on national security, public safety, and protecting consumers.
FOUR Space, Wireless Telecommunications, Office of Engineering and Technology, Office of Managing Director and Office of Economics and Analytics The Commission will hear presentations from the Space Bureau, the Wireless Telecommunications Bureau, the Office of Engineering and Technology, the Office of Economics and Analytics and the Office of Managing Director on the agency's work on the future of communications.
